@import"https://fonts.googleapis.com/css2?family=Inter:wght@300;400;500;600;700;800&display=swap";@tailwind base;@tailwind components;@tailwind utilities;@layer base{*{@apply transition-colors duration-200;}body{@apply bg-gray-50 dark:bg-gray-900 text-gray-900 dark:text-gray-100;font-family:Inter,-apple-system,BlinkMacSystemFont,Segoe UI,Roboto,sans-serif}:root{--card-bg: #ffffff;--primary-color: #0ea5e9;--primary-hover: #0284c7}.dark{--card-bg: #1f2937}}@layer components{.btn-primary{@apply bg-sky-500 text-white px-5 py-2.5 rounded-lg hover:bg-sky-600 transition-all disabled:opacity-50 disabled:cursor-not-allowed font-medium shadow-sm hover:shadow-md;}.btn-secondary{@apply bg-gray-200 dark:bg-gray-700 text-gray-900 dark:text-gray-100 px-5 py-2.5 rounded-lg hover:bg-gray-300 dark:hover:bg-gray-600 transition-all font-medium;}.input-field{@apply w-full px-4 py-3 border border-gray-300 dark:border-gray-600 rounded-lg bg-white dark:bg-gray-800 text-gray-900 dark:text-gray-100 focus:outline-none focus:ring-2 focus:ring-sky-500 dark:focus:ring-sky-400 focus:border-transparent transition-all;}.card{@apply bg-white dark:bg-gray-800 rounded-xl shadow-sm p-6 transition-all hover:shadow-md;}}
